What is the average salary in Saint Cloud, MN?
Job seekers in Saint Cloud, MN, can expect a range of salaries across different professions. Salaries in the area vary based on the industry and the level of experience. The average yearly salary in Saint Cloud stands at $56,643, offering a good financial outlook for many residents.
Here are some typical salary ranges in the area:
- 23.38% of jobs pay between $27,130 and $38,300
- 27.46% of jobs pay between $38,300 and $49,470
- 14.39% of jobs pay between $49,470 and $60,640
- 8.30% of jobs pay between $60,640 and $71,810
- 5.96% of jobs pay between $71,810 and $82,980
- 5.61% of jobs pay between $82,980 and $94,150
- 4.61% of jobs pay between $94,150 and $105,320
- 1.91% of jobs pay between $105,320 and $116,490
- 1.68% of jobs pay between $116,490 and $127,660
- 0.76% of jobs pay between $127,660 and $138,830
- 0.95% of jobs pay over $138,830

How does the cost of living in Saint Cloud, MN compare to the national average?

The cost of living in Saint Cloud, Minnesota, presents a favorable comparison to the nationwide average. According to recent data, the overall cost of living index for Saint Cloud is 92, which is slightly lower than the national average of 100. This suggests that residents in Saint Cloud generally spend less on their living expenses compared to the average American.
Housing costs in Saint Cloud are notably lower, with an index of 88, which is 12% below the national average. This indicates that housing expenses are more affordable in Saint Cloud. Groceries show a small increase, with an index of 96, which is only 4% higher than the national average. Utilities and transportation costs also remain slightly below the national average, with indices of 93 and 92, respectively. Healthcare costs, while still relatively low at an index of 90, are slightly below the national average at 10%. Miscellaneous expenses in Saint Cloud have an index of 94, which is 6% below the national average, offering additional savings. These figures provide a clear picture of the cost of living in Saint Cloud and highlight its affordability.
